After 30 years, the National Youth Orchestras of Scotland is delighted to announce its welcome return to the Edinburgh International Festival 2018. In this, Scotland's designated Year of Young People the Festival is showcasing extraordinary young classical talents from both sides of the Atlantic and are beyond proud to be back, and part of such a remarkable line up of young talented musicians.

This extraordinary tour opens in Dundee at the glorious Caird Hall, where NYOS Symphony Orchestra perform a selection of pieces from its full summer programme. A programme, in which the orchestra explores the arresting oceanic recreations of Debussy’s iconic La mer and the alluring Spanish colours of his exotic Ibéria. In between, we have two rarely heard masterpieces from a century ago: Lili Boulanger’s impressionistic conjuring of a spring morning and a remarkable poignant work by Scottish composer Cecil Coles, written while the composer was stationed in France during the First World War.
